Comprehensive Overview
Banner Medical Center in Sun City West is part of Banner Health, one of the largest nonprofit healthcare systems in the United States. Banner Health operates 30 hospitals and several specialized facilities across six states: Arizona, California, Colorado, Nebraska, Nevada, and Wyoming. Known for its commitment to patient care, medical innovation, and community service, Banner Health has established a strong reputation for excellence in the healthcare industry.

Services and Specialties
Banner Medical Center offers a wide array of medical services and specialties designed to cater to the diverse needs of its patients. These include:
-
Emergency Services: A 24/7 emergency department provides immediate medical care for critical and urgent conditions. Equipped with advanced technology and staffed by experienced healthcare professionals, the emergency department ensures timely and effective treatment.
-
Cardiology: The cardiology department specializes in diagnosing and treating heart-related conditions. Services include diagnostic testing, interventional cardiology procedures, and cardiac rehabilitation programs. The team of cardiologists and cardiac specialists are dedicated to providing comprehensive cardiac care.
-
Orthopedics: The orthopedic department focuses on the diagnosis and treatment of musculoskeletal conditions, including arthritis, fractures, and sports injuries. Services include joint replacement surgery, arthroscopic procedures, and physical therapy. The orthopedic team helps patients regain mobility and improve their quality of life.
-
Geriatrics: With a focus on the healthcare needs of seniors, the geriatrics department provides specialized care for older adults. Services include comprehensive geriatric assessments, chronic disease management, and memory care. The geriatric team is committed to helping seniors maintain their health and independence.
-
Surgical Services: Banner Medical Center offers a range of surgical services, from minimally invasive procedures to complex surgeries. The surgical team includes experienced surgeons, nurses, and support staff who work together to ensure optimal patient outcomes.
-
Rehabilitation Services: The rehabilitation department provides physical therapy, occupational therapy, and speech therapy services. These services help patients recover from injuries, illnesses, and surgeries, improving their functional abilities and overall well-being.

Tips and Expert Advice
Navigating the healthcare system can be complex, but with the right information and strategies, patients can optimize their healthcare experience at Banner Medical Center in Sun City West.
-
Establish a Primary Care Physician: Having a primary care physician (PCP) is essential for maintaining overall health and coordinating care. A PCP can provide routine check-ups, vaccinations, and screenings, as well as manage chronic conditions. Establishing a relationship with a PCP allows for personalized care and continuity of treatment.
- Your primary care physician serves as the central point of contact for all your healthcare needs, ensuring that your medical history is well-documented and that you receive consistent and coordinated care.
- Regular visits to your PCP can help detect potential health issues early, allowing for timely intervention and treatment. This proactive approach can significantly improve your long-term health outcomes.
-
Understand Your Insurance Coverage: Understanding your health insurance coverage is crucial for managing healthcare costs. Familiarize yourself with your insurance plan's benefits, copays, deductibles, and network providers. This knowledge will help you make informed decisions about your healthcare and avoid unexpected expenses.
- Contact your insurance provider to clarify any questions you have about your coverage. Understanding the specifics of your plan will enable you to maximize your benefits and minimize out-of-pocket costs.
- Be aware of any pre-authorization requirements for certain procedures or treatments. Obtaining pre-authorization when necessary can prevent claim denials and ensure that you receive the coverage you are entitled to.
-
Prepare for Appointments: Preparing for medical appointments can help you make the most of your time with healthcare providers. Write down your symptoms, medications, and any questions you have before the appointment. Bring a list of your current medications and any relevant medical records.
- During the appointment, be clear and concise when describing your symptoms and concerns. Provide as much detail as possible to help your healthcare provider accurately assess your condition.
- Don't hesitate to ask questions and seek clarification on any information you don't understand. It's important to be fully informed about your health and treatment options.
